Featured dishes

View full menu
Slow Roasted Pork Bites
Roasted slow & low & tossed in a bourbon maple glaze topped with sesame seeds & green onion
Truffle & Parmesan Fries
Our fabulous crispy fries tossed in truffle oil & sprinkled with parmesan cheese, served with garlic aioli (v)
Calamari
Crispy fried calamari served with your choice of tzatziki, chipotle, garlic aioli or sweet chilli sauce extra sauce $3
Hummus & Pita
Grilled naan served with authentic smooth hummus (v)
Fried Chicken Sandwich
Fried chicken thighs served on a portuguese bun with tomatoes, lettuce, ranch mayo, bacon marmalade & pickled onions

When I leave San Francisco I live to find, and expect to rarely encounter, a wayside place which provides respite from daily activity. A welcoming place that appeals and satisfies my senses. One of these rarest gems is in downtown Smithers.

Sisters Moe and Michel have curated and deliver an experience that deeply satisfies in an ambiance that relaxes, with service executed with aplomb, and a wholesome menu and bar that nourish.

The modern, large yet inviting environment is interestingly eclectic without being distracting: Sitting there feels, well, welcoming. A stuffed owl, carved Indonesian doors, themed bathrooms, English candelabras and Moe’s photography of people and food encourage you to snuggle up with one of an evolving collection of excellent cocktails (thanks Jason!), rum, whiskey, wine or beer.

RoadHouse’s coziness comes with crisp, attentive service that appears effortless but exists only when servers, cooks and owners enjoy working with each other. Their banter shows this is clearly the case.

The food is consistently excellent with the exception of their pulled pork poutine: That bowl of deliciousness is sublime. Assuage your hunger with comfort (poutine, chowder and bacon bites), healthy (great salads and fresh ingredients), food that is dressed up (duck confit) or down (street tacos and Korean barbecue). Each delivered satisfaction.

I would be embarrassed to admit how many days in a row I ate dinner there, if I didn’t relish the memory of every morsel and sip. My experiences there now define my expectations for warmth, service and food that satiates when I look for my next...

ACCESSIBILITY: Front entrance with two 32 inch pull doors has a 4 inch edge. Side door is accessible, depending on mobility. Tables and chairs are free standing with the exception of the bankquettes. Accessible single toilet on ground floor has assist rails. STAFF: Very friendly and knowledgeable staff. FOOD: Outstanding. Although I have had to ask for al dente pasta, and a ramen dish with an overcooked egg was a little disappointing. Aside from some small nuances in preference, this place has amazing food! COCKTAILS: Between Mo and James, you cannot go wrong. Tell them your favourite flavours and ask for a mystery cocktail. You will definitely be pleased! FOOD I HAVE TRIED: FRIED CDICKEN: excellent crisp, almost like a Korean style fried chicken. Delicious. RAMEN: Good, but ask for a soft boiled egg. The broth is the best part. The pork needs to pop, but unfortunately blends into the broth. TURKEY POT PIE: Just like Mom used buy! This is amazing! A must try. BANGERS AND MASH: The Queen herself would be pleased. A massive serving of this colonist classic is spot on.
